The 330104-00-06-05-01-CN is a compact industrial proximity probe designed for precise, non-contact measurement of shaft displacement and vibration. The “CN” suffix typically indicates a region-specific configuration or customization, often related to standards or connection formats.
It belongs to the mature 3300 XL 8 mm platform, known for high stability, modular compatibility, and long-term reliability in industrial monitoring systems.

The 330104-00-06-05-01-CN is engineered for continuous monitoring of rotating machinery using eddy current sensing technology.
It works by generating a high-frequency electromagnetic field at the probe tip. When a conductive object (such as a rotating shaft) enters this field, eddy currents are induced, causing a measurable change in impedance. This change is converted into an electrical signal proportional to displacement.
This model features a compact probe body combined with a short cable, making it ideal for installations where space is limited. It is commonly used in integrated systems where sensor placement must be precise but physically constrained.
The stainless steel housing ensures resistance to corrosion and mechanical stress, while the sealed structure provides reliable operation in dusty or oily environments.
